The discussion centers on identifying the best resources for learning quantum field theory (QFT). "An Introduction to Quantum Field Theory" by Peskin and Schroeder is highlighted as the standard textbook for QFT. Participants reference a thread that lists various books and lecture notes on the subject, emphasizing the wealth of available literature. Additionally, Srednicki's QFT book is mentioned, noting that it is available in PDF format for free access.
